About Formance

Formance is on a mission to redefine how developers interact with money as a first-class primitive and compose with finance.

Hidden through permissioned, vendor-locked infrastructure, money needs to rewire itself to empower product-first companies with the ability to create innovative financial applications. With the Formance Platform, we're putting agnostic primitives in the hands of engineers and their team. These primitives are available as open-source packages, and can be wired to the financial partner of your choice.

What you’ll do
You’ll be the operational backbone supporting leadership and helping scale the company. This hybrid role combines executive support, administrative coordination, and office management, with plenty of room to grow and shape the scope based on your strengths.

Executive Assistant role:

  • Undertake all administrative and backoffice tasks (URSSAF, DGIP, OPCO, insurance, Visa requests, etc.)
  • Guarantee all pre-accounting to ensure smooth monthly closing and meet all deadlines (Pennylane, Qonto, AGICAP),
  • Prepare invoices and oversee supplier payments
  • Gather key information for strategic document preparation, reports, presentations and provide administrative support to the Chief of Staff 
  • Organise company events (onsite and offsite) in France and abroad
  • Manage executive & employees travels, booking flights, hotels, and transfers, while anticipating logistical needs.
  • Provide day-to-day support on HR-related tasks such as onboardings, offboardings, answer employee’s requests and so on (Payfit)
  • Help structure internal processes (Drive, Notion) and ensure smooth internal communication

Office Management: 

  • Oversee the smooth running of the offices in Paris, Lyon and NYC
  • Coordinate with HR, operations and suppliers (supplies, budget, maintenance)
  • Act as key liaison with the executive committee. Ensure clear and prompt communication, with company executives and follow up appropriately, following processes already in place.
  • Help cultivate a great workplace culture and contribute to internal events
